Panther/Live

Annotation

This recording was out circa mid 1990's on the German Jazzdoor label. Jazzdoor published very design and extremely good unofficial soundboard recordings of jazz artists using the early 90s European copyright loopholes. They managed very well, moving their distribution from independent to the big companies allowing their CDs to be displayed on the high-street retailer in Europe, i.e. FNAC in France. When Panther/Live was displayed on the shelves of the FNAC Paris, Dreyfus Records - whom Marcus Miller was in contract with - sent an injunction to all FNAC outlets in order to remove them on the same day.

However, Jazzdoor re-released the album in 2004, possibly sanctioned by the artist. It is included in the discography on the artist's website.

Recording date and place

Recorded live in the USA, 1988 (printed on all known releases of this album)

IIt is not very likely that this album was recorded as early as 1988. The musicians and the setlist point more towards a time after the release of his 1993 album The Sun Don't Lie, from which many of the tracks played come from. Therefore, the specified location should also be considered questionable.
